Google Cloud SAP Analytics Architect, Google Cloud in Mexico City, Mexico

Please submit your resume in English - we can only consider applications submitted in this language.

Only applications of candidates with Mexican citizenship will be evaluated for this role in compliance with the provisions of Article 7 of the Federal Labor Law.

Minimum q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, a related technical field, or equivalent practical experience.

  • 2 years of experience managing client-facing projects to completion, troubleshooting clients technical issues, working with Engineering, Sales, services, and customers.

  • Experience with SAP Analytics Suite implementation, data extraction tools/methodologies, SAP ERP modules, process/data flows and cloud migration strategies.

  • Experience using SAP HANA in-memory database, SAP BusinessObjects, and SAP Analytics Cloud.

Preferred qualifications:

  • 7 years of experience in technical client service.

  • Experience implementing SAP analytic projects for live SAP environments on public cloud, architecting around SAP data migration strategies, and SAP Cortex on Google Cloud Platform.

  • Experience in SAP Analytics suite of tools such as SAP BW, HANA, DWC and data extraction tools and methodologies including data services, SLT/Qlik for real time and batch data loading.

  • Experience in SAP Migration to cloud, high availability setup, downtime optimization, and performance improvements.

  • Knowledge of SAP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) modules including process and data flows at table level and data warehouse concepts.

The Google Cloud team helps companies, schools, and government seamlessly make the switch to Google products and supports them along the way. You listen to the customer and swiftly problem-solve technical issues to show how our products can make businesses more productive, collaborative, and innovative. You work closely with a cross-functional team of web developers and systems administrators, not to mention a variety of both regional and international customers. Your relationships with customers are crucial in helping Google grow its Cloud business and helping companies around the world innovate.

In this role, you will work with Google's strategic customers on projects to provide management, consulting, and technical advisory to customer engagements. You will also work with client executives and key technical leaders to deploy solutions on Google Cloud Platform. You will work with Google partners servicing customer accounts to manage projects, deliver consulting services, and provide technical guidance. You will travel up to 25% of the time for client engagements.

Google Cloud accelerates organizations’ ability to digitally transform their business with the best infrastructure, platform, industry solutions and expertise. We deliver enterprise-grade solutions that leverage Google’s cutting-edge technology – all on the cleanest cloud in the industry. Customers in more than 200 countries and territories turn to Google Cloud as their trusted partner to enable growth and solve their most critical business problems.

  • Work with customer technical leads, client executives, and partners to manage and deliver implementations of cloud solutions.

  • Work with internal specialists and Product and Engineering teams to package best practices, methodologies, and published assets.

  • Interact with Sales, partners, and customer technical stakeholders to manage project scope, priorities, deliverables, risks/issues, and timelines for client outcomes.

  • Advocate for customer needs in order to overcome adoption blockers and drive new feature development based on field experience.

  • Propose architectures for SAP products and build SAP data and analytics solutions according to complex customer requirements and implementation best practices.
